The WG9925682123 Front Balance Clip Assembly is an OEM-grade solution specifically designed for SITRAK medium and heavy trucks that demand flawless anti‑roll bar fixation. Unlike generic aftermarket clips that rely on low‑grade spring steel, this component integrates a high‑carbon heat‑treated steel core with a precision‑moulded elastomer interface, providing permanent clamping force even under extreme torsional stress. The assembly features a dual‑locking geometry that eliminates axial play and prevents the balance bar from shifting during cornering or off‑road articulation.

Every WG9925682123 Front Balance Clip Assembly undergoes 100% dimensional inspection using laser‑mapping technology. The clamp body is fabricated from 65Mn spring steel with a thickness of 4.5 mm, shot‑peened for residual compressive stress, and finished with a 12‑µm zinc‑nickel coating that withstands 720 hours of salt spray (ASTM B117). The integrated rubber cushion is made of high‑density natural rubber (70 Shore A) bonded to the steel via a proprietary vulcanisation process that resists delamination up to 120°C. Field data from SITRAK C9H 6×6 vehicles in Australian road‑train service shows zero clamp fatigue or coating corrosion after 600,000 km.

Technical Specifications – WG9925682123 Front Balance Clip Assembly

ParameterSpecification (WG9925682123)
OEM NumberWG9925682123
Part NameFront Balance Clip Assembly
Steel Grade65Mn spring steel
Hardness (HRC)42 – 48 HRC
Coating TypeZinc‑Nickel (ZnNi) + clear sealer
Salt Spray Resistance≥720 h (ASTM B117)
Clamping Force (static)22.5 kN ±5%
Rubber MaterialHigh‑density natural rubber, 70 Shore A
Service Temperature-50°C to +130°C
Fatigue Life (axial torque)> 2 million cycles @ 15 kN load

Professional Installation Procedure – WG9925682123 Front Balance Clip

Begin by lifting the front axle and supporting the chassis on jack stands. Remove the original stabilizer bar link and bracket bolts. Clean the bar contact surface using a wire brush and brake cleaner. Place the WG9925682123 Front Balance Clip Assembly over the anti‑roll bar with the rubber cushion centered on the wear mark. Apply thread locker (medium strength) to the M12 mounting bolts and torque to 105 Nm in a cross pattern. Use a torque wrench; overtightening beyond 120 Nm may damage the rubber insert.

After installation, verify that the clip does not contact any surrounding components (steering linkages, air lines). Lower the vehicle and perform a road test, listening for creaking or rattling. Re‑torque bolts after 500 km of initial operation. For optimal service life, inspect the WG9925682123 Front Balance Clip Assembly every 80,000 km for coating damage or rubber cracking. Never reuse a removed clip; always install a new genuine WG9925682123 unit to maintain clamping force integrity.

Advanced Manufacturing & Quality Control – WG9925682123

Each genuine WG9925682123 Front Balance Clip Assembly is manufactured in an IATF 16949:2023 certified facility. The 65Mn steel strips are blanked using 250‑ton servo presses with carbide dies, achieving burr-free edges (<0.05 mm). Forming is performed on CNC bending cells with real‑time angle feedback (tolerance ±0.5°). After heat treatment in continuous mesh‑belt furnaces (argon atmosphere), every part undergoes 100% hardness testing via Rockwell and eddy current crack detection.

The zinc‑nickel coating is applied in a rack‑plating line with strict thickness control (12 ±2 µm). Adhesion is verified by cross‑hatch tape test (ISO 2409, class 0). The rubber cushion is vulcanised in a heated compression mould (160°C, 8 minutes) and peel‑tested (≥4 N/mm). Each batch is sampled for dynamic clamp load retention (1 million cycles @ 10 Hz). Only lots achieving 98% load retention receive the WG9925682123 stamp. QR‑coded traceability includes coil certificates, plating bath logs, and torque‑to‑yield validation.

Store clips in dry environment (below 35°C) and use within 36 months of production date.

For best results, avoid installing the WG9925682123 Front Balance Clip Assembly on bent or pitted stabilizer bars; replace the bar if wear exceeds 1.5 mm depth. Always use new mounting bolts (grade 10.9) and apply correct torque. Inspect clips every major service; if rubber shows hardening or steel has any cracking, replace immediately.
